About Round Prairie Park

How often do you come across a campground that combines prairie serenity with a dash of rugged simplicity? Round Prairie Park near Stockport, Iowa, breaks from the typical expectation with its tranquil, undeveloped charm, offering a true escape into nature for those seeking primitive camping and outdoor recreation.

Located just 15 minutes from Stockport in southeast Jefferson County, this 101-acre park features a mix of native prairie, timbered areas, and two fishing ponds stocked with bass, catfish, and bluegill—ideal for angling enthusiasts. The campground provides primitive sites, a shelter house for gatherings, and a basic pit-toilet facility, ensuring a rustic yet manageable outdoor experience. Surrounding trails make it a haven for bird-watchers, hikers, and nature lovers aiming to immerse themselves in Iowa's pastoral beauty.

Situated off Tamarack Avenue, Round Prairie Park places visitors within easy reach of the culturally vibrant town of Fairfield and its unique attractions, while maintaining its secluded ambiance.
